Index: head/sys/modules/iscsi/Makefile =================================================================== --- head/sys/modules/iscsi/Makefile (revision 300837) +++ head/sys/modules/iscsi/Makefile (revision 300838) @@ -1,20 +1,25 @@ # $FreeBSD$ +SYSDIR?=${.CURDIR}/../.. +.include "${SYSDIR}/conf/kern.opts.mk" + .PATH: ${.CURDIR}/../../dev/iscsi/ KMOD= iscsi SRCS= iscsi.c SRCS+= icl.c SRCS+= icl_soft.c SRCS+= icl_soft_proxy.c SRCS+= opt_cam.h SRCS+= bus_if.h SRCS+= device_if.h SRCS+= icl_conn_if.c SRCS+= icl_conn_if.h -#CFLAGS+=-DICL_KERNEL_PROXY +.if ${MK_OFED} != "no" || defined(ALL_MODULES) +CFLAGS+=-DICL_KERNEL_PROXY +.endif MFILES= kern/bus_if.m kern/device_if.m dev/iscsi/icl_conn_if.m .include